Portland's real estate market is known for its variety of charming neighborhoods, offering more affordable housing options compared to Seattle, with lower median home prices and rental rates.
Seattle's real estate market tends to be more expensive, driven by the city's booming tech industry and limited space, resulting in high demand for housing and luxury properties.
The overall cost of living in Seattle is about 22% higher than in Portland, influenced by housing, utilities, and lifestyle expenses, making it relatively costly.
Utilities in Seattle are around 11% more expensive than in Portland, driven by population density and older infrastructure increasing costs, unlike Portland's milder climate.
